  • I now know that owning four cats means you can’t have fabric on the bed that a claw can get snagged on.
  • I now know that owning four cats means you’ll have cat hair all over the place even if you brush your cats often.
  • I now know that owning four cats means you will have to wash ALL your bedding once a week so get something that will fit in your machine and washes well.
  • I now know that owning four cats means that I can’t have that pretty solid lime green comforter I love because it stains.
  • I now know that owning four cats means white sheets are not an option.
  • I now know that owning four cats means earth tones can camouflage a stain until it’s washday.
  • I now know that owning four cats means “champagne or taupe” is a very cat friendly color.
  • I now know that owning four cats means taupe is a great color choice when you have gray cats.
  • I now know that owning four cats means having beautiful colors on my bed is completly out of the question.
  • I now know that when you buy a really soft blanket, it feels really good and you have to knead on it.
  • I now know that owning for cats mean my bed will never look made.
  • I now know that owning four cats means I have to hide my beautiful red button tufted decorative pillow because Levi thinks it’s fun to pull the buttons off.
  • I now know that owning four cats means that my blankets are now a playground.
  • I now know that owning four cats means my blankets have to be thick enough to protect my toes from being bitten.
